Output 4ec384bb20a5c94cfd6bb7072a226c7f607ad5e659bbc80a413d5f9861403b16:1

value
14026296
script pubkey
OP_0 OP_PUSHBYTES_20 b129a57b87998d30a3b1bf30775fda52b684c1e1
address
bc1qky5627u8nxxnpga3huc8wh7622mgfs0pu9qs7f
transaction
4ec384bb20a5c94cfd6bb7072a226c7f607ad5e659bbc80a413d5f9861403b16
confirmations
124904
spent
true